Subject: my cpu wont startOS: windows xpCPU/Ram: hhgyttModel/Manufacturer: hp |
Comment: about a month ago, i went to turn on my computer, and all it did was click. i took a closer look and the power light and LED light in the back were blinkin simultaniusly with this clickin sound. no fans or any thing. if u have anyidea what is goin on or how to fix this, i would appreciate it.

Reply: (edit)Exactly. Many people mistakenly refer to their PC tower & everything inside of it as a CPU, but that's not correct. A CPU is a chip within the computer tower. Here's an example of one: http://www.teschke.de/heatpipes/INT... Did you open the case to see if it's loaded with dust? Your problem is most likely the power supply, but do some troubleshooting before you buy anything.
